CHARACTERIZATION AND EVALUATION OF LIGHT METAL HYDRIDES.

Abstract

Evaluation of Beany material of recent production shows distinct improvements in the material's particulate structure. Propellant mixes using the newer materials gave low mix viscosity prior to ball milling. Analytical data are summarized. A Beany double-base propellant was fired in a small motor at low chamber pressure. A significantly lower efficiency was obtained than was measured in a control motor fired under closely similar (mass flow rate, pressure) conditions. Experimental work was continued in obtaining basic data for LMH-1 propellant shelf-life prediction. Initial data on gas generation rates, gas diffusion and solubility are reported. (Author)
